Full Notice Text
IN THE CIRCUIT COURT OF THE FIRST CIRCUIT STATE OF HAWAIISUMMONSSTATE OF HAWAIITO: WANES BALJIAN and HALO HALO HAWAII LLC dba AL PHILLIPS THE CLEANER HAWAIIYOU ARE HEREBY NOTIFIED THAT MELISSA MORGAN, Plaintiff, has filed a Complaint against you in Civil no. 1CCV-25-0001856 (TRT) in the Circuit Court of the First Circuit, State of Hawaii, wherein Plaintiff prays for monetary damages against you in the above-entitled Court. YOU ARE HEREBY SUMMONED to appear in the courtroom of the Honorable Taryn R. Tomasa at Honolulu District Court of the First Circuit, 1111 Alakea Street, Courtroom 5C, Honolulu HI 96813 on June 16, 2026, at 9:00 o'clock a.m. or to file an answer or other pleading and serve it before said day upon David K. Ahuna, plaintiff's attorney, who's address is 46-005 Kawa Street, Suite 307, Kaneohe, Hawaii 96744. If you fail to do so, judgement by default will be taken against you for the relief demanded in the Complaint.DATED: Honolulu, Hawaii, April 13, 2026./s/Teresa TerrellClerk of the above-entitled CourtDel Mar TimesPublished: 4/23, 4/30, 5/7, 5/14/26
